SHY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2025 in Review

1,155 of the 7,620 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ares 1-3 Year Treasury Bond ETF (SHY) for Q3 2025, worth a combined $19.5B — up 4% from $18.7B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 98 funds closed out of SHY and 94 opened new positions — a net loss of 4 holders — while 449 trimmed existing stakes and 436 added.

The largest buyer was CAPTRUST Financial Advisors, adding an estimated $520M. The largest seller was AssetMark Inc, cutting an estimated $421M.
